- The adverbial יַחְדָּו modifies both verbs and indicates that both actions happen "together," i.e., "at the same time" (HALOT; cf. Isa 46:2; Ps 35:26): "I both lie down and sleep" >> "I will fall asleep as soon as I lie down" (cf. Prov 3:24; Baethgen 1904, 11).
